DisclosureLens links filings into incidents through layered matchers: deterministic rules (same source document, multistate filings of one breach, tight-window same-victim pairs), a weighted-similarity scorer for cross-source candidates, and an operator review queue for everything uncertain. Each link records its own method and confidence — shown per filing in the timeline below. The system defaults to NOT merging when uncertain, because a false merge (collapsing two unrelated breaches) is more harmful than a false split (showing related filings separately); uncertain pairs route to human review instead of auto-merging. Vice Media, LLC reported a data breach affecting 1,724 individuals, including 6 Maine residents. The breach was discovered on April 4, 2022, and the cause was undetermined. The compromised information included names and Social Security numbers. Vice Media provided affected individuals with 12 months of complimentary credit and identity monitoring services.

Vice Media LLC notified Vermont consumers of a March 2022 incident involving unauthorized access to an internal email account. The breach may have exposed names and other personal information. Vice engaged cybersecurity firms, implemented additional security measures, and offered Equifax credit monitoring and identity theft insurance to affected individuals.
Vice Media LLC reported a data security incident to New Hampshire AG on Jan 30, 2023. On March 29, 2022, Vice detected unusual activity involving 105 emails sent from an internal account. Investigation revealed unauthorized access to an internal email account containing names and SSNs of 4 NH residents. No evidence of actual disclosure was found. Vice engaged cybersecurity firms, secured its network, and offered 12 months of credit monitoring via Equifax.
